In adults and older children, evidence consistent with relative separation between selective and sustained attention, superimposed upon generally positive inter-test correlations, has been reported. Here we examine whether this pattern is detectable in 5-year-old children from the healthy population. A new test battery (TEA-ChJ) was adapted from measures previously used with adults and older children and administered to 172 5-year-olds. Test-retest reliability was assessed in 60 children. Ninety-eight percent of the children managed to complete all measures. Discrimination of visual and auditory stimuli were good. In a factor analysis, the two TEA-ChJ selective attention tasks (one visual, one auditory) loaded onto a common factor and diverged from the two sustained attention tasks (one auditory, one motor), which shared a common loading on the second factor. This pattern, which suggests that the tests are indeed sensitive to underlying attentional capacities, was supported by the relationships between the TEA-ChJ factors and Test of Everyday Attention for Children subtests in the older children in the sample. It is possible to gain convincing performance-based estimates of attention at the age of 5 with the results reflecting a similar factor structure to that obtained in older children and adults. The results are discussed in light of contemporary models of attention function. Given the potential advantages of early intervention for attention difficulties, the findings are of clinical as well as theoretical interest.  相似文献

The matrix metalloproteinase (MMP) stromelysin-3 (ST3) has been shown to be involved in malignant tumor progression and therefore represents an attractive therapeutical target. In order to screen for ST3 synthetic inhibitors, we have produced and purified the catalytic domain of ST3, matrilysin, stromelysin-2, and membrane type-1 MMP from inclusion bodies in a bacterial system. Our strategy allowed the purification of MMPs directly in the active form, thereby avoiding in vitro activation. A total of 140,000 synthetic compounds from the Bristol-Myers Pharmaceutical Research Institute chemical deck were tested, using a substrate-based colorimetric enzymatic assay, in which ST3 activity was evaluated through its ability to cleave and inactivate alpha-1 proteinase inhibitor. One ST3 inhibitor belonging to the cephalosporin family of antibiotics was thereby identified.  相似文献

The recessive muted (mu) and pearl (pe) mutations on Chromosome (Chr) 13 cause pigment dilution and platelet storage pool deficiency (SPD) in mice. In addition, mu causes inner ear abnormalities and pe has symptoms associated with night blindness. Using an interspecific backcross involving the wild-derived Mus musculus musculus (PWK) stock, we have mapped 33 microsatellite markers and four cDNAs relative to mu, pe, and another recessive mutation, satin (sa). Analyzing a total of 528 backcross offspring, we found tight linkage between the pigment loci and several microsatellite markers (D13Mit87, D13Mit88, D13Mit137 with mu; and D13Mit104, D13Mit160, D13Mit161, and D13Mit169 with pe). These markers should aid the eventual molecular identification of these specific SPD genes.  相似文献

Evidence for leucine zipper motif in lactose repressor protein   总被引:10,自引:0,他引:10  
Amino acid sequence homology between the carboxyl-terminal segment of the lac repressor and eukaryotic proteins containing the leucine zipper motif with associated basic DNA binding region (bZIP) has been identified. Based on the sequence comparisons, site-specific mutations have been generated at two sites predicted to participate in oligomer formation based on the three-leucine heptad repeat at positions 342, 349, and 356. Leu342----Ala, Leu349----Ala, and Leu349----Pro have been isolated and their oligomeric state and ligand binding properties evaluated. These mutant proteins do not form tetramers but exist as stable dimers with inducer binding comparable with the wild-type protein. Apparent operator affinities for lac repressor proteins with mutations in the proposed bZIP domain were significantly lower than the corresponding wild-type values. For these dimeric mutant proteins, the monomer-dimer equilibrium is linked to the apparent operator binding constant. The values for the monomer-monomer binding constant and for the intrinsic operator binding constant for the dimer cannot be resolved from measurements of the observed Kd for operator DNA. Further studies on these proteins are in progress.  相似文献

A significant portion of murine hepatocyte beta-glucuronidase is maintained within the endoplasmic reticulum (ER) by complex formation with the esterase active site of the protein egasyn. The carboxyl-terminal propeptide of the precursor form of glucuronidase appears important in localization of glucuronidase to the ER since a naturally occurring mutation in it is associated with decreased levels of ER glucuronidase. A sequence similarity was noted between the carboxyl-terminal propeptide and portions of the conserved sequences of the reactive site region of members of the serpin (serine proteinase inhibitor) superfamily. Also, previous studies had shown that a synthetic peptide, corresponding to the propeptide region, was a specific and potent inhibitor of the esterase activity of purified egasyn. Taken together, these results suggest that (a) the egasyn-glucuronidase system may use a novel mechanism related to that of serine proteinases and their inhibitors in complex formation and in subsequent localization of glucuronidase within the ER and that (b) a possible function of ER glucuronidase is to modulate the esterase activity of egasyn.  相似文献

An equation is given for the estimation of selective values from data obtained by mark-recapture experiments, assuming that selective pressures remain constant while the experiments are carried out. The equation does not have an explicit solution but can readily be solved using a trial-and-error method. The use of the equation is illustrated on some data reported byKettlewell et al. (1969) from an experiment involving typica and edda morphs of the moth Amathes glareosa. It is found that the edda morph apparently had a selective advantage of about 12% per day compared to the typica morph and that this is significantly different from zero. Using another methodKettlewell concluded that the selective advantage of the edda morph was only 7% and that this was not statistically significant.  相似文献
